Just to add to Miss Info's comments on EPHB, I find his coordination astounding. The album he has out right now,
Turtle Wars, is tinged with interludes and bits of Public Enemy stylings. This one-man-band bad ass has great sensibilities when it comes to album production. The vocals don't overpower the music itself while he keeps the drums as dirty at the guitar. Obviously, it's not high production but nor is it lo-fi. The sound is expansive while being right up front with the noise.
